Marion police searching for a missing teenager
Marion, Iowa – The Marion Police Department is seeking the public’s assistance in locating a missing teenager.
Talaya McGee, 14, is the girl they’re seeking for.
She was last seen in Squaw Creek Trailer Park on Friday.
Her outfit included of black trousers, green Crocs, a gray long-sleeved shirt, and a blue bag.
Anyone with information is asked to contact police at (319) 377-1511.
